A hockey puck is given an initial velocity such that vx = 11 m/s and vy = 23 m/s, where the x­y plane is horizontal. (a) What is the initial speed of the puck? (b) What angle (in degree) does the initial velocity make with the x axis? (c) What angle (in degree) does the initial velocity make with the y axis?
